I will miss Alan as he was always a gentleman and knew pretty much EVERY road in the US! Plus he was a night owl like me, so he and I were always among the
last ones up at any Rally we were usually at together, so many a long conversation ensued.
Back in the day he was quite a rider and rode all over the US and Canada! He was always giving great recommendations for rides and such. I remember the first time I went out to Vintage Motorcycle Days (probably around 1988) I started out at the Gummikuh Rally in NY. When he learned of my ride his eyes lit up and he said "Oh you HAVE to go over the bridge at Ogdensburg, New York! It is over a mile long, all steel and is the steepest ascent and descent that I have ever been on! EVERYONE has got to do it at least ONCE in their LIFE!!" So I added it into my very fluid route and he was absolutely spot on! It ended up being a trip highlight!! Ride on Alan, we will miss you! Phil PD SALES - NOT ONE BIKE ALIKE!! I used to see Alan at Yankee Beemer campouts in Vermont in the mid-
90's. Alan impressed me as a true cross-country motorcycle adventurer. At the campfire, he explained how to do an oil change in the parking lot of a store; putting all the old, used oil back into the oil bottles for disposal. He described how to plan for a cross-country trip, how to do laundry on the road and he gave me camping tips. At that time, Alan had returned from several weeks (months?) touring out west and I hadn't yet been outside of New England. He inspired me to want to do the same kind of traveling: ride all day and camp out for the night. He worked at a motorcycle shop somewhere in eastern NY. The last time I saw him was at Vanson Leather and he had a Moto Guzzi Quota. That was at least 5 years ago. Jim Costello introduced me to Alan. I remember alan with his really big 3/4 length motorcycle riding jacket and his white-tanked BMW GS with a unique tank logo (not a BMW roundel). What was the tank logo that Alan had applied? |
